    Since we already got a dynamic traction feature in the form of dust/gravel/grass from cars coming from an off-track I think the physics side of things in Raceroom would be able to support weather effects, unless it runs into issues if you try to apply it on the whole circuit, not just small patches as we have now. But we're so far away from the proper weather implementation, we don't even have dynamic track/air temperatures.
